Web4 de jun. de 2024 · Adding “weight” or “body size” as protected grounds in all human rights legislation will help ensure that all instances of weight discrimination are prohibited. This is the best way to limit this unnecessary discrimination and provide greater protection across Canada.

Web25 de jul. de 2024 · Ontario Nurses’ Association, has found that Public Health Sudbury and Districts (PHSD) breached the Ontario Human Rights Code when it terminated an employee who refused to comply with the employer’s vaccination policy on the basis of a protected ground under the code – that being the employee’s creed.
